Chevron Print Decor - A Popular Pattern

As you might suspect I spend quite a bit of time online working with social networking sites that are heavy on images such as Pinterest, Instagram, Facebook and more. Over the past several months I noticed a design pattern that was trending--the Chevron print. I loved it right away but wasn't sure if I'd ever be able to reproduce it in my work since everything I create is hand painted. There are so many lines--and straight lines at that! I never thought it could be reproduced by my hand so I decided I would simply enjoy this print pattern and let go of any idea of ever painting it.

Then, as we all know, the universe unfolds in it's own mysterious way. A few weeks ago I had a customer place an order requesting I use this Chevron print on a name sign for a baby girl's nursery. I was excited at the idea, but then immediately I became nervous because I couldn't imagine how I'd be able to recreate the pattern and keep my lines straight and keep the final sign looking clean and neat.

However, after some thought I figured out how I could do it. I found a pattern online...there are so many from which to choose...

I resized it so the pattern would work well on the size sign I have. (I didn't want to make a pattern that was really small on a larger piece of wood--that would be very tedious and hard to paint.) Then I cut along the lines, traced the edge of the print onto the piece of wood...

Next I painted it...

And voila! Here's the finished Chevron Print Room Decor Sign!

I am very please with how it turned out and it wasn't hard at all!
